Perryopolis man bitten by rattlesnake in Dunbar Township

By Josh Krysak heraldstandard.Com 1 min read

A Perryopolis man is in critical condition in an area hospital after being bitten by a rattlesnake in Dunbar Township Sunday afternoon.

Rick Adobato, director of Fayette EMS said the 47-year-old man arrived at the Fayette EMS station at the Fayette County Fairgrounds at 2:28 p.m. reporting he had been bitten by the snake.

“According to the victim and his family, they were hiking in an area of the Dunbar Mountains when he dropped his walking stick,” Adobato said. “He apparently bent down to retrieve it when the snake bit him on one of his fingers.”
